Portishead Dock, North Somerset. In 1860 a deep water dock was built to accomodate large ships that had difficulty reaching Bristol Harbour. With the closure of the adjacent power stations in 1982 the dock lost its primary purpose and was closed in 1992. It has since been redeveloped as a marina. Photographed here in November 1970 by Jim Hancock. Discover Historic England images to buy as prints, wall art or for licensing.
